Struktur EMRCOLORMATCHTOTARGET (wingdi.h)

Struktur EMRCOLORMATCHTOTARGET berisi anggota untuk rekaman metafile yang disempurnakan ColorMatchToTarget .

Sintaks

typedef struct tagCOLORMATCHTOTARGET {
  EMR   emr;
  DWORD dwAction;
  DWORD dwFlags;
  DWORD cbName;
  DWORD cbData;
  BYTE  Data[1];
} EMRCOLORMATCHTOTARGET, *PEMRCOLORMATCHTOTARGET;

Anggota

emr

Struktur dasar untuk semua jenis rekaman.

dwAction

Tindakan yang akan diambil. Anggota ini bisa menjadi salah satu nilai berikut.

Tindakan Makna
CS_ENABLE Memetakan warna ke gamut warna perangkat target. Ini memungkinkan pemeriksa warna. Semua perintah gambar berikutnya ke DC akan merender warna seperti yang akan muncul di perangkat target.
CS_DISABLE Menonaktifkan pemeriksa warna.
CS_DELETE_TRANSFORM Jika manajemen warna diaktifkan untuk profil target, nonaktifkan dan hapus transformasi yang digabungkan.

dwFlags

Parameter ini bisa menjadi nilai berikut.

Bendera Makna
COLORMATCHTOTARGET_EMBEDED Menunjukkan bahwa profil warna telah disematkan di metafile.

cbName

Ukuran nama profil target yang diinginkan, dalam byte.

cbData

Ukuran data profil target mentah dalam byte, jika terpasang.

Data[1]

Array yang berisi nama profil target dan data profil target mentah. Ukuran array adalah cbName + cbData. Jika cbData bukan nol, data profil target mentah dilampirkan dan mengikuti nama profil target di lokasi Data[cbName].

Persyaratan

Persyaratan Nilai
Klien minimum yang didukung Windows 2000 Professional [hanya aplikasi desktop]
Server minimum yang didukung Windows 2000 Server [hanya aplikasi desktop]
Header wingdi.h (sertakan Windows.h)

Lihat juga

ColorMatchToTarget

Struktur Metafile

Gambaran Umum Metafiles